Because we know that humans are fallible and will have crashes and cars, the Automobile Industry and the national Highway Transportation Safety Administration or nhtsa has spent the last half century designing and building automobiles to be safer when they crash with innovations like seatbelts and airbags. Today we are designing and building automobiles to avoid collisions entirely with technologies like for him to backup cameras and blind spots warnings.
